At the time the defendant's attorney made this motion for a physical examination, the plaintiff's attorney asked that a copy of the doctor's report be made available to him. The defendant's counsel argued against the disclosure of the medical report to the plaintiff's attorney, claiming that the policy of the Justices of the Fourth Judicial District did not require that such report be given to the plaintiff or his attorney.
